John (Jack)DAVIESMr John Davies, of Raven Park, Haslingden, died on Saturday, June 6 at Turfcote Nursing Home, Haslingden, aged 87. Jack, as he was known, leaves his partner Barbara, daughter Lisa, Barbara’s sons Andrew, Jason and Simon, nephew Duncan, and also grandson Ryan. Jack has lived in the Haslingden and Helmshore area all his life, working as a Quarryman at Grane Road, Haslingden for many years, Porritt and Spencer Sunnybank Mill, Helmshore, and retired from Musbury Fabrics, Helmshore. His National Service was with the Royal Signals serving in Germany and he was a member of the Royal British Legion, Helmshore. In his youth he was a keen boxer and footballer, and later in life he enjoyed travelling and caravanning. He had a love of animals, especially dogs and horses. Jack was a gentleman and one of the nicest men you would ever meet. The funeral took place on Wednesday, June 17, with service and cremation at Accrington Crematorium, officiated by Philip Norris. Donations in memory of Jack are for Bleakholt Animal Sanctuary care of the family. Funeral director: Josephine Durning for Johnson, Durning and Woods Funeral Service.
